What are Instrumentation General Foremen?

Instrumentation General Foremen are supervisory professionals who oversee the installation, maintenance, and repair of instrumentation systems in industrial settings such as oil and gas, manufacturing, or power plants. They manage teams of instrumentation technicians and ensure that all work meets safety and quality standards. Their responsibilities include coordinating schedules, troubleshooting technical issues, and ensuring compliance with project specifications and regulations. Instrumentation General Foremen play a key role in ensuring that complex instrumentation systems operate efficiently and reliably.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Instrumentation General Foreman,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Instrumentation General Foreman, you need strong knowledge of industrial instrumentation, electrical systems, and supervisory experience, typically supported by a technical diploma or journeyman certification in instrumentation. Familiarity with PLCs, DCS, calibration tools, and CMMS software is essential for managing installations and troubleshooting. Effective le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help coordinate teams and ensure project timelines are met. These abilities are critical for maintaining safety, efficiency, and quality in complex industrial environments.

What is the difference between Instrumentation General Foreman vs Instrument Technician?

AspectInstrumentation General ForemanInstrument Technician
CredentialsRelevant certifications, experience in supervisionTechnical certifications, specialized training
Work EnvironmentOversees projects, manages teams on-sitePerforms installation, maintenance, troubleshooting
Industry UsageCommonly in construction, oil & gas, manufacturingUsed in maintenance, commissioning, fieldwork

The Instrumentation General Foreman typically supervises and coordinates instrumentation projects, requiring leadership skills and relevant certifications. In contrast, the Instrument Technician focuses on hands-on installation, maintenance, and troubleshooting of instrumentation systems. Both roles are essential in industrial settings, but the Foreman has a broader supervisory scope, while the Technician is more technical and operational.

What are some common challenges faced by an Instrumentation General Foreman in managing large-scale projects?

As an Instrumentation General Foreman, you may encounter challenges such as coordinating multiple teams, ensuring all instrumentation work meets strict safety and compliance standards, and adapting to project changes or unexpected technical issues. You’ll also need to manage scheduling and resource allocation effectively, while maintaining clear communication between engineers, technicians, and other departments. Successfully overcoming these challenges requires strong leadership, attention to detail, and the ability to quickly resolve on-site problems to keep projects on track.

Job description

General Summary

Responsible to the Maintenance Manager for planning & supervising of the activities of the Electrical & Instrumentation Departments.  He will be available for consultations & assistance in problems of maintenance, staff & operations throughout the mill.

Prerequisites

 Education:                        BS Degree in Engineering

 Work Experience:             Five (5) years in Engineering Preferred, with two (2) of those years in the Pulp & Paper Industry.

 Skills:                                Possess written & verbal communication skills & engineering knowledge.

 Training:

  Other:                              Ability to work well with all levels of management

Essential Functions The essential functions of this position include but are not limited to...

1.      Supervise the activities of all personnel assigned to the Electrical & Instrumentation Departments.

2.      Maintains compliance with ISO Quality System responsibilities.

3.      Schedule & coordinate Electrical & Instrument Maintenance shutdowns, repairs & construction work in cooperation with the Mechanical Maintenance area.  Operating Departments & Plant Engineering Department.

4.      Issue requisitions for repair parts & supplies necessary to Electrical & Instrument Maintenance work, which are not furnished by Central Storeroom or Engineering.

5.      Direct the administration of company policy & programs pertaining to the performance, training, safety & morale of all personnel under his supervision.

6.      Cooperate in the establishment & continuance of a safety program to education the foremen & hourly workers in safe work methods & have a comprehensive knowledge of possible electrical & instrument safety hazards in the mill.

7.      Keep the Maintenance Reliability Manager informed of all current & long-range personnel & maintenance problems & plans.

8.      Assist in preparing cost estimates for work orders & capital jobs & in preparation of the annual departmental operating & capital budgets.

9.      Maintain accurate & up-to-date maintenance records & information on all machinery, equipment & buildings.

10.    Coordinate activities with outside contractors working in his area of responsibility.
